    Standardizing the Technical Interview Procedure

    The lack of uniformity in the technical interview process has been a main obstacle in tech hiring. Every interviewer brings to the table their own particular style, expertise, and prejudices, therefore lacking standardizing and impartiality in the assessment of applicants. InterviewVector solves this by offering a consistent structure for technical interviews, therefore guaranteeing that every applicant is evaluated using the same standards and degree of challenge.

    It makes sure every interview is carried out with the same degree of rigor and attention to detail by using a staff of very skilled and experienced interviewers. This standardization not only gives applicants a fairer playing field but also gives companies a consistent and dependable foundation for choosing which candidate to hire.

    Continuous Improvement and Feedback Loop at All Times

    InterviewVector’s method of technical screening focuses on ongoing improvement made possible by a feedback loop. Every interview ends with a chance for comments on performance between the applicants and the interviewers. By means of this perceptive data, the interview technique is improved, therefore guaranteeing future relevance and efficacy of this strategy.

    Because of the proactive information from participants, it is able to spot areas that need improvement, adjust to the often-shifting corporate standards, and keep ahead of the curve in terms of technology recruitment.
